当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

云服务器用什么操作系统,云服务器操作系统全景解析,主流系统对比与选型指南

云服务器用什么操作系统,云服务器操作系统全景解析,主流系统对比与选型指南

云服务器操作系统是构建IT架构的核心基础,主流系统包括Linux发行版(如Ubuntu、CentOS、Rocky Linux、AlmaLinux)及Windows Se...

云服务器操作系统是构建IT架构的核心基础,主流系统包括Linux发行版(如Ubuntu、CentOS、Rocky Linux、AlmaLinux)及Windows Server,Linux系统以开源、高安全性、灵活定制为核心优势,其中Ubuntu凭借社区活跃和开发者友好成为开发测试首选,CentOS/RHEL系列(现由Rocky/AlmaLinux承接)则更适合企业级应用;Windows Server凭借与Windows生态的深度整合,在Windows应用、游戏服务器及混合云场景中占据优势,选型需综合考虑应用场景:Web服务倾向Ubuntu,数据库选RHEL,Windows生态项目则必选Windows Server,容器化趋势下,Kubernetes原生支持CentOS Stream、CoreOS等轻量化系统,同时云厂商提供的定制OS(如AWS Linux、Azure Linux)通过集成云服务接口降低运维成本,需注意CentOS EOL影响迁移计划,Windows Server 2022引入的混合云架构及Linux内核18版本对安全补丁的支持周期差异,建议结合业务需求、技术栈及长期运维成本综合决策。

云服务器的操作系统生态现状

在数字化转型浪潮中,云服务器作为企业IT架构的核心组件,其操作系统选择直接影响着服务器的性能、安全性、维护成本和扩展能力,截至2023年,全球云服务器市场规模已突破2000亿美元,操作系统作为底层支撑系统,形成了以Linux、Windows为核心,容器操作系统、云原生OS为补充的多元化生态,本文将从技术架构、应用场景、商业策略三个维度,深度解析云服务器操作系统的演进逻辑与选型策略。


主流操作系统技术架构对比

1 Linux操作系统体系

1.1 内核演进路线

Linux内核版本从0.01(1991年)到6.1(2023年)的迭代过程中,形成了稳定(Long Term Support, LTS)与前沿(Testing)双轨机制,当前主流发行版呈现三大分支:

云服务器用什么操作系统,云服务器操作系统全景解析,主流系统对比与选型指南

图片来源于网络,如有侵权联系删除

  • 企业级系统:Red Hat Enterprise Linux(RHEL)通过订阅模式提供商业支持,其Rocky Linux和AlmaLinux的社区化转型正在重构市场格局
  • 社区主流版:Ubuntu LTS版本(20.04/22.04)凭借APT包管理器和安全框架(Security Center)占据全球云服务器市场38%份额
  • 云优化版本:AWS Amazon Linux 2023引入BPF虚拟化支持,性能较传统系统提升27%

1.2 架构特性分析

  • 微内核设计:相较于Windows的全功能内核,Linux通过模块化设计实现内核与用户空间的解耦,在容器场景下内存占用降低42%
  • 文件系统演进:XFS/XFS+、Btrfs和ZFS构成分层存储体系,Btrfs的COW(Copy-on-Write)机制使分布式存储效率提升35%
  • 安全模型:SELinux增强型强制访问控制(Enforcing Mode)在金融云环境中的应用,使特权操作攻击成功率下降68%

2 Windows Server操作系统

2.1 功能模块架构

基于NT内核的Windows Server 2022构建了四大核心组件:

  • Hyper-V虚拟化:支持动态内存分配和实时迁移(Live Migration),在混合云场景中实现跨平台资源调度
  • Nano Server:无界面精简版系统,启动时间缩短至8秒,资源消耗降低90%
  • 容器子系统:Hyper containers与Docker 1.13+的集成,使Windows Server容器运行时效率提升40%
  • 安全增强:Windows Defender ATP实现端点检测与响应(EDR),误报率控制在0.3%以下

2.2 商业化特征

  • 许可模式:基于核心数的付费机制(每核心$200/年),在计算密集型场景中成本比Linux高2-3倍
  • 企业级集成:与Azure Stack HCI、System Center等产品的深度耦合,形成微软云生态闭环
  • 更新策略:通过台式机式更新(Windows Update for Business)实现安全补丁7天延迟部署

3 容器化操作系统

3.1 基础架构对比

  • Docker Engine:基于Linux cgroups和命名空间实现轻量级隔离,平均容器启动时间1.2秒
  • Kubernetes集群管理:通过API Server、Controller Manager、Scheduler等组件构建分布式控制系统
  • Sidecar架构:在微服务部署中,辅助容器(如Istio Sidecar)处理网络策略,使服务间通信延迟降低65%

3.2 云原生OS演进

  • CoreOS:原红帽开源项目,通过etcd分布式键值存储实现无中心化集群管理
  • Alpine Linux:最小化镜像(5MB)支持 musl libc,在边缘计算场景部署效率提升3倍
  • rkt(Rocket):CoreOS开发的容器运行时,支持 layered filesystem 和 multi-stage builds

操作系统选型决策矩阵

1 技术选型维度分析

维度 Linux系统 Windows Server 容器OS
启动时间 30-60秒(带Swap文件) 90-120秒(含引导程序) <5秒(仅镜像)
内存占用 1-2GB(基础版) 4-8GB(Nano Server) 50-100MB
许可成本 免费(商业发行版年费$200) $200/核心/年 免费
安全更新 6-72小时(社区版) 14天(企业支持) 实时同步
虚拟化支持 KVM/QEMU(无性能损耗) Hyper-V(集成优化) 轻量级虚拟化

2 应用场景匹配模型

2.1 企业级应用推荐

  • 金融核心系统:RHEL 9.0 + SELinux,满足PCI DSS合规要求,事务处理性能达120万TPS
  • ERP部署:Windows Server 2022 + SQL Server 2022,事务日志延迟<50ms
  • 物联网平台:Alpine Linux + Docker 23.0,支持ARMv8架构设备批量部署

2.2 新兴技术适配

  • Serverless架构:AWS Lambda支持Linux/Windows函数镜像,执行时间<100ms
  • 边缘计算节点:YunoHost定制OS,支持APache IoTDB时序数据库,端到端延迟<10ms
  • AI训练集群:NVIDIA NGC容器库(基于Alpine)+ PyTorch 2.0,GPU利用率提升40%

云服务商定制系统实践

1 公有云生态构建

云服务商 定制OS特性 典型应用场景
AWS Amazon Linux 2023(RHEL兼容层) EC2实例、 ECS集群
Azure Azure Linux Agent 2.0 Azure Stack Hub、AKS
腾讯云 TencentOS-TC 2.0(基于Debian) 腾讯云服务器(CVM)
华为云 HarmonyOS Server 1.0(微内核) 华为云Stack、FusionCube

2 安全增强方案

  • SUSE Linux Enterprise Server:集成SUSE Linux Enterprise Security Manager(SLE-SM),实时监控200+安全指标
  • Windows Server 2022:BitLocker全盘加密 + Windows Defender Exploit Guard,内存保护模块阻止85%已知漏洞利用
  • 云原生安全:Kubernetes 1.27引入Pod Security Admission(PSA),限制特权容器执行权限

性能优化技术路径

1 虚拟化性能调优

  • Linux KVM优化:配置numa绑定(numactl -i balanced)使内存访问延迟降低32%
  • Hyper-V动态调参:设置VMMemMaxMB=1.5*物理内存,避免内存过载导致OoS(Out-Of-Storage)
  • 容器CGroup限制:为Docker容器设置cpuset=0-3,4-7,确保CPU核心利用率>90%

2 存储子系统优化

  • Btrfs多卷配置:在云服务器部署中创建10个10TB Btrfs子卷,IOPS性能达12000
  • ZFS压缩策略:启用zfs send/receive压缩(zstd-1x),数据传输速率提升65%
  • Windows Server存储空间优化:使用Storage Spaces Direct实现跨节点RAID-5,重建时间缩短70%

3 网络性能增强

  • Linux TCP参数调整:设置net.core.somaxconn=10240 + net.ipv4.tcp_max_syn_backlog=65535,提升TCP连接数上限
  • Windows Server 2022:启用TCP Offload(IP/IPv6)使网络吞吐量达25Gbps(10Gbps网卡)
  • 容器网络策略:Calico网络插件实现BGP路由自动发现,跨AZ延迟<5ms

成本效益分析模型

1 隐性成本识别

成本类型 Linux系统 Windows Server 容器OS
运维人力 5人/100节点 2人/100节点 2人/100节点
灾备成本 $5/节点/月 $15/节点/月 $3/节点/月
合规认证 ISO 27001(自建) $5000/年(第三方) ISO 27001(继承)

2 ROI计算案例

某电商企业在双11期间部署300台云服务器:

  • 方案A(Linux):初始成本$3000,运维成本$600,灾备$150 → 总成本$4750
  • 方案B(Windows):初始成本$9000,运维$1800,灾备$450 → 总成本$11350
  • 方案C(容器集群):初始成本$1500,运维$300,灾备$900 → 总成本$2700

3 长期TCO趋势

根据Gartner 2023年数据,云计算操作系统TCO年均增长率:

  • 传统企业级系统:+8.7%(受订阅模式影响)
  • 开源容器系统:-2.3%(社区支持降低成本)
  • 混合云架构:+15%(跨平台管理复杂度)

未来技术演进方向

1 操作系统架构革新

  • 分布式内核:Facebook Diem OS(原ReactOS)实验性支持跨数据中心进程通信
  • AI原生OS:Google Fuchsia引入Flutter UI引擎,推理任务延迟<10ms
  • 量子计算支持:IBM Quantum OS正在开发量子内存管理模块

2 云原生安全演进

  • 硬件级隔离:Intel TDX技术实现操作系统级加密隔离,内存加密强度达AES-256
  • 零信任架构:Windows Server 2025测试版集成Just-In-Time(JIT)凭据管理
  • 区块链审计:Hyperledger Fabric与Linux内核集成,操作日志上链存证

3 环境可持续性实践

  • 绿色计算OS:SUSE OpenStack Platform 17优化CPU调度算法,PUE值降至1.12
  • 能耗感知调度:AWS EC2 Linux实例支持CPU空闲检测,自动降频节能30%
  • 碳足迹追踪:Red Hat奎斯特系统(Qhovor)记录每个操作的环境影响数据

典型企业实践案例

1 某跨国银行混合云架构

  • 基础设施层:AWS EC2(Windows Server 2022) + 华为云ECS(RHEL 9.0)
  • 容器化改造:迁移200+业务模块至Kubernetes集群,容器化率从15%提升至82%
  • 安全成果:通过Windows Defender ATP与SELinux联动,阻止金融交易欺诈攻击127次/月

2 智能制造企业边缘计算部署

  • 操作系统选择:基于Alpine Linux的定制OS,集成OPC UA协议栈
  • 性能指标:在工业网关中实现200ms内响应PLC指令,内存占用<200MB
  • 成本节约:通过容器化部署,边缘节点数量减少40%,运维成本下降65%

常见误区与解决方案

1 选型决策陷阱

  1. 过度追求开源:忽视商业支持SLA(如RHEL 24/7响应时间<2小时)
  2. 容器性能误解:未考虑Cgroups资源限制导致Pod争抢CPU
  3. 混合架构风险:Windows与Linux跨域身份认证失败率高达38%

2 优化方案

  • 混合部署策略:在Windows Server上运行Hyper-V虚拟机隔离Linux环境
  • 性能监控工具:使用eBPF技术构建Cilium网络插件,实时检测容器异常
  • 自动化运维:Ansible+Kubernetes Operator实现配置变更自动化,部署错误率<0.1%

行业发展趋势预测

1 2024-2026年关键趋势

  1. 操作系统即服务(OSaaS):AWS Lambda式操作系统按使用量计费,预测成本下降40%
  2. 统一管理平台:VMware vSphere 2025支持跨Linux/Windows/容器混合集群管理
  3. 自修复系统:Google BeyondCorp 3.0实现异常进程自动终止与镜像重建

2 技术融合方向

  • AI与OS结合:Meta Llama 3模型内嵌操作系统调度模块,任务分配效率提升50%
  • WebAssembly支持:Rust语言在WASM虚拟化环境中运行速度达原生代码85%
  • 区块链融合:Hyperledger Besu区块链节点直接集成Linux内核,交易确认时间<500ms

结论与建议

云服务器操作系统选择需构建多维评估模型,重点考虑:

云服务器用什么操作系统,云服务器操作系统全景解析,主流系统对比与选型指南

图片来源于网络,如有侵权联系删除

  1. 业务连续性需求:金融行业推荐RHEL+Windows混合架构
  2. 技术债务控制:传统应用优先选择Windows Server,新项目建议采用容器化方案
  3. 成本敏感度:年预算<50万美元企业适用社区版Linux+自建运维团队
  4. 安全合规要求:GDPR区域部署需满足数据本地化存储(如AWS Outposts)

未来3-5年,云原生操作系统将占据80%市场份额,企业需建立OS即代码(OS-in-Code)的持续交付体系,通过AIOps实现自动化运维,建议每季度进行OS健康检查,重点关注内核版本更新(如Linux 6.2引入的CFS v3调度器)、安全补丁覆盖率(目标>95%)和资源利用率(CPU>85%,内存>70%)。

(全文共计3187字)


本报告基于2023-2024年技术演进路径分析,结合AWS、Azure、华为云等Top 5云服务商白皮书数据,通过架构对比、成本模型、实战案例构建完整决策框架,建议企业在选型前进行POC测试,重点关注容器与裸金属混合部署场景的性能瓶颈,以及跨云平台迁移的兼容性问题。

黑狐家游戏

发表评论

最新文章